The Nutritional Profile and Culinary Appeal of Bone Marrow
Found sequestered within the internal cavities of animal bones, bone marrow is a luxurious, highly nutritious fatty tissue. Renowned for its opulent, buttery profile, it serves as a superb source of collagen, essential vitamins, and wholesome fats. Gastronomes frequently refer to roasted bone marrow as the „nectar of the gods,” given its decadent quality that mirrors the richness of high-end butter.
Varieties and Preparation Styles
Bone marrow is categorised primarily into two types: red and yellow. When prepared for consumption, it is often served as „canoes”—long bones bisected lengthwise to expose the marrow. Whether incorporated into hearty broths or served as a standalone delicacy, it is praised for being an affordable yet sophisticated ingredient that cooks remarkably quickly.
Recommended Culinary Techniques
- Roasted Marrow Bones: Arrange split beef bones in an oven preheated to 200°C–220°C. Season with sea salt and garlic, then roast for 15 to 20 minutes until the marrow reaches a soft, molten consistency.
- Nutrient-Rich Broths: Gently simmer bones over an extended period to extract minerals, collagen, and deep flavour for stocks or soup bases.
- Sauce Enrichment: Whisk melted marrow into risottos, gravies, or pan-deglazing liquids to impart a velvety depth and richness.

The Nutritional Profile and Health Benefits of Bone Marrow
Bone marrow is a potent source of metabolic fuel and bioactive compounds that may assist in systemic inflammation management. Each 14-gram tablespoon provides 110 calories, 12 grams of fat, and 1 gram of protein, which makes it an efficient, albeit heavy, energy source for those needing to maintain weight.
| Nutrient | Amount per 14g serving |
|---|---|
| Calories | 110 kcal |
| Total Fat | 12g |
| Vitamin B12 | 7% RDI |
| Riboflavin | 6% RDI |
Key Micro-Nutrients and Health Benefits of Bone Marrow
Beyond its caloric load, this Bone Marrow food provides essential elements for energy metabolism. It contains glucosamine, chondroitin, and collagen, which are building blocks for cartilage health. The presence of adiponectin helps assist in fat breakdown and the maintenance of insulin sensitivity, while glycine and conjugated linoleic acid (CLA) serve as anti-inflammatory agents.
Navigating Fat Content and Beef Bone Marrow Nutrition
Bone marrow is exceptionally high in cholesterol and fat, containing roughly 88 grams of fat and 300 milligrams of cholesterol per 100-gram serving. For patients recovering from intestinal transplantation, this high lipid density can often prove difficult to digest, potentially triggering gastrointestinal distress or malabsorption issues.
Important: Because a 100-gram portion provides over 800 calories and includes stearic acid—a specific type of saturated fat—it is generally ill-advised for individuals managing hyperlipidaemia or heart disease. Practical Steps to Prepare Bone Marrow
The only safe way to consume the Bone Marrow food discussed here is to ensure it is thoroughly roasted, as raw consumption poses a significant risk of pathogen exposure to immunocompromised patients. Follow these steps to ensure you prepare it safely in your own kitchen:
- Request „canoe-cut” or „rounds” Beef femur bones from your butcher.
- Soak bones in salted ice water in the refrigerator for 12 to 24 hours to remove impurities.
- Arrange bones marrow-side up on a foil-lined sheet.
- Roast at 450°F (230°C) for a cooking time of 15 to 25 minutes until soft and bubbling.
- Serve with a fresh parsley and lemon salad to help cut the richness.

Frequently Asked Questions
Is it safe to consume Bone Marrow if I have a history of fat malabsorption?
No, it is generally not recommended as the extremely high fat content can exacerbate malabsorption issues and lead to significant digestive discomfort. You should discuss any high-fat additions to your diet with your clinical nutrition team before proceeding.
Can I use Bone Marrow as a primary source of protein in my meals?
No, Bone Marrow is primarily a lipid source, providing only about 1 gram of protein per tablespoon. It should be viewed as an energy-dense condiment rather than a viable protein foundation for your recovery diet.
Are there specific Beef bone types that are better for roasting?
Yes, femur bones are the preferred source because they contain the highest concentration of marrow. You should specifically request „canoe-cut” bones from your butcher to ensure the marrow is easily accessible for roasting and serving.
How long can I store roasted Bone Marrow in the refrigerator?
Roasted marrow should ideally be consumed fresh; however, if you must store it, keep it in an airtight container for no longer than two days. Always ensure it is reheated thoroughly to a safe temperature before consumption to maintain food safety standards.
